Output 65fd607f778a354e4fccb7c4ec99cdee395861f7701ac76e6520efdf33c3ab68:2

value
83307989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b49ee4daaebadd73659921fddcbaf9134dea51 OP_EQUAL
address
32Pm2daFz6yrZzzLT78kWnUeCoRT46PqxJ
transaction
65fd607f778a354e4fccb7c4ec99cdee395861f7701ac76e6520efdf33c3ab68
spent
true